The 'redline' is your 'Luck Adjusted Winnings': it comprises of all your EV Diffs + the outcome ($Won) of the game.
The EV Diff value changes based on the ICM, and on how many players are left: a big coinflip hand in the bubble will result in a much larger EV Diff, than if you are in a coinflip in the early stages of the game for all your chips.


As a result, it isn't really fair to filter out 5-5 players, 6-6 players (or for example filter out a specific blind level) as the hands you filter out, have no real meaning, without all the OTHER hands and the outcome of the game.
(similarly the cEV reports are pretty useless for ALL tournies)



Extreme Example:
Let's suppose you play a $10 6max STT.
1th hand (6-handed) you win KK vs AA
in the bubble (3-handed) you lose with AA vs KK and are eliminated in 3th place.
After winning KK vs AA you end up with $20 in equity, your equity was only $4 (20% of $20), so the hand results in a EV Diff of -$16.
AA vs KK (you have a 80% to end up with $30 in equity, and 20% to end up with $0, so you have +$24 equity. You lose the hand and end up with $0 equity. (EV Diff is +$24)
Luck Adjusted Winnings (LAW) is: -$16 -(-$10) + $24 = +$18

If you filter out 6-6 handed, what will this show you exactly?
It will show you EV Diff -$16 (and you lost the game) for a LAW of +$6. (-$16 - (-$10))
3-3 handed EV Diff of +$24, for a LAW of +$34 ($24- (-$10))
